My Henry 30-30 has a slightly longer length of pull than my Marlin due to the factory recoil pad. Not and issue but it does make it shoulder a little differently than the Marlin and my Winchester Model 94 that came with solid buttplates.
What I do like about the Henry is the tube magazine that makes it much easier to load and remove shells without having to repeatedly cycle the action. However, the factory trigger on the Henry needed work to reduce it from what felt like 10 pounds. I'm sure it wasn't that bad but all my other rifles are set no higher than 2-1/2 to 3 pounds.
